Output d85d410715236156ca547ae18d2c603df40a1c799ec9f7421ef989a90dc575dc:30

value
1146120
script pubkey
OP_0 OP_PUSHBYTES_20 7ef0245cb4af656084be92d6fd41c0b4fb68a8e7
address
bc1q0mczgh954ajkpp97jtt06swqknak3288vhz2ep
transaction
d85d410715236156ca547ae18d2c603df40a1c799ec9f7421ef989a90dc575dc
spent
true